2015 Fireworks




Raytown Fireworks Rules 

SHOOTING OF FIREWORKS IS PROHIBITED ON RAYTOWN
PARKS AND OTHER PUBLIC PROPERTY AND IN BUSINESS
DISTRICTS. 

CONSUMER FIREWORKS MAY ONLY BE SOLD
AND DISCHARGED DURING THE FOLLOWING TIMES:

Sold between 6:00 a.m. on June 29 and 10:00 p.m. on July 4.
Discharged on July 4 between the hours of 10:00 a.m. and
11:00 p.m. 

BOTTLE OR STICK ROCKETS, MISSILES, SKY LANTERNS AND ROMAN
CANDLES ARE PROHIBITED FROM BEING SOLD OR
DISCHARGED AT ANY TIME WITHIN THE CITY OF RAYTOWN

ALL PERSONS SHOOTING FIREWORKS MUST HAVE A 2015 RAYTOWN FIRE DISTRICT FIREWORKS PERMIT, WHICH IS AVAILABLE FREE AT ANY RAYTOWN FIREWORKS TENT OR FIRE STATION

Fire sprinkler pipe break forces evacuation of Raytown nursing home


Media Release

Raytown, MO 23:30 hrs. Two seperate breaks in the large pipes supplying the fire sprinklers at the Hidden Lake Care Center located at 11400 Hidden Lake Drive, Raytown, MO 64133 forced the evacuation of 48 residents on August 4, 2014.  The residents were relocated to nearby facilities operated by the same company.  

The water breaks are expected to be repaired by late Tuesday and the Facility will also be required to have the electrical system inspected by a licensed electrition and the water damage professionally mitigated.
